Introducing secure cloud storage with zero knowledge encryption. Infosys cryptarithmetic questions and answers 2019 2020. If the same letter occurs more than once, it must be assigned the same digit each time. Data sufficiency elitmus preparation tips cryptarithmetic multiplication quantitative ability home problem solving data sufficiency tutorial verbal ability percentage discussion board permutation and combinations cryptarithmetic tutorial contact us. Cryptarithmetic problem 01 detailed solution youtube. Pdf solution of a classical cryptarithmetic problem by. Puzzles and curious problems 1931 and a puzzlemine undated. Solving cryptarithmetic problems using parallel genetic. This article, along with any associated source code and files. Apr 04, 2011 cryptarithmetic is a suitable example of the constraint satisfaction problem. Solving elitmus cryptarithmetic questions in logical. Cryptarithmetic problem it is an arithmetic problem which is represented in letters. Cryptarithmetic questions are most asked questions in the infosys recruitment and elitmus exam. The cryptarithmetic puzzle problem and a first model.
In ths lesson, i will show you, using my own techniques and thinking ability, how to solve. In cryptarithmetic problem, the digits 09 get substituted by some possible alphabets or symbols. Each letter, symbol represents only one digit throughout the problem. How to solve cryptarithmetic problems elitmus basics. Cryptarithmetic multiplication problems with solutions download. Well show you examples using both solvers, starting with cpsat. Cryptic math puzzles, cryptarithms, alphametics, cryptarithmetic. However when the code is run,there is no output can anybody tell me what is wrong with the program.
Cryptarithmetic is a mathematical puzzle which involves the replacement of digits with alphabets, symbols and letters. Question published on this portal are same as difficulty level of elitmus examination. The problem was to find one solution, so the problem is solved. Solving problems like these involves understanding some basic principles and rules of addition and a lot of trial and error. As an example we can say that two words base and ball, and the result is games. Download cryptarithmetic addition questions and answers pdf.
Like ten different letters are holding digit values from 0 to 9 to perform arithmetic operations correctly. Tips and tricks and shortcuts to solve cryptarithmetic. This tutorial will be very helpful in solving those questions. Sep 18, 2017 follow the below steps and you can get the solution. Simple cryptarithmetic puzzle solver in java, c, and python. A permutation is a recursive function which calls a check function for every possible permutation of integers. Solution of a classical cryptarithmetic problem by using parallel genetic algorithm conference paper pdf available october 2014 with 4,696 reads how we measure reads. You have to find the value of each letter in the cryptarithmetic. After replacing letters by their digits, the resulting arithmetic operations must be correct. Decoded numbers cant begin with 0, for example, 08. Instead of providing a description, a cryptarithmetic problem can be better described by some constraints.
This problem has 72 different solutions in base 10. Now if we try to add base and ball by their symbolic digits, we will get the answer games. This definitely complicates the code but leads to a tremendous improvement in efficiency, making it much more feasible to solve large puzzles. Pdf solving cryptarithmetic problems using parallel. Solving cryptarithmetic puzzles backtracking8 geeksforgeeks. Doing so, they miss an important and instructive phase of the work.
This is the notverysmart version of cryptarithmetic solver. Now that your system is up and running if not, see getting started, let us solve a cryptarithmetic puzzle with the help of the ortools library in this section, we describe the problem and propose a first model to solve it. If you have a question, then post it i will answer it. Java program to solve simple cryptarithmetic puzzle stack. Constraint satisfaction problems csp a powerful representation for discrete search problems.
Each letter or symbol represents only one and a unique digit throughout the problem. Two single digit numbers sum can be maximum 19 with carryover. Cryptarithmetic tutorials and problems with solutions in logical reasoning. Select functions examination pattern unit digit method references register consider donation. The values of a characterletter can not be changed, and should remain same throughout starting character of number can not be zero example 0341 should be simply 341. Contribute to javedk16 cryptarithmeticproblem solverinjava development by creating an account on github. There is no equation to solve, but there are logical techniques that can help.
In cryptarithmetic puzzles, mathematical equations are written using letters. I also wrote another cryptarithmetic puzzle solver in c. Some of the important rules and guidelines are addressed below to help you gain better insights on the topic. A cryptarithm is just a math puzzle or a math riddle. For example, if we assign the characters starting from the ones place and moving to the left, at each stage, we can verify the correctness of what we have so far before we continue onwards. Cryptarithmetic problems are puzzles like the following.
Well show the variables, the constraints, the solver invocation, and finally the complete programs. Your job now is find the numerical values of these letters. Tips and tricks and shortcuts to solve cryptarthmetic questions as mentioned in the introduction page cryptarithmetics is considered to be, both a science as well as an art. M ost of the students are having difficulties in solving the calendar. Cryptarithmetic multiplication problems with solutions download pdf free download as pdf file. Cryptarithmetic puzzle is a number puzzle in which a group of arithmetical operations has some or all of its digits replaced by letters or symbols, and where the original digits must be found. For example, given two, two, and four, the program. Python program to solve cryptarithmetic problems u.
The idea is to assign each letter a digit from 0 to 9 so that the arithmetic works out correctly. Write a program that finds a solution to the cryptarithmetic puzzle of the following. Cryptarithmetic problem in artificial intelligence, computer. This art was originally known as letter arithmetic or verbal arithmetic. Nov 18, 2019 as a programmer, i naturally gave this a go as soon as i saw it with the aid of a computer. Newspapers and magazines often have cryptarithmetic puzzles of the form. There are no mathematical formulas to solve these problems.
The user has requested enhancement of the downloaded file. See statistics to find puzzles with unique solution. The science and art of creating and solving cryptarithms. To solve an alphametic, simply type it in the 3 input boxes above and then press the button solve. A solution to the puzzle is an assignment of a single digit to each symbol.
This package also includes puzzle generators written in perl. Firstly go through the cryptarithmetic tutorial in sequence mentioned below and then try to solve the problem by your own. A cryptarithmetic is a genre of mathematical puzzle in which the digits are replaced by letters of the alphabet or other symbols. N0 a1 l2 g3 r4 b5 t20 i dont think you should create a program to get a solution, just use algebra. This calculator is a solver of cryptarithmetic puzzles. Hence apart from logic, one must use hisher presence of mind and a little bit of common sense to solve the problems.
Solving elitmus cryptarithmetic questions in logical reasioning sectionmethodi in elitmus test you will be getting 3 questions30 marks on cryptic multiplication. Newspapers and magazines often have crypt arithmetic puzzles of the form. Developed a code to solve cryptarithmetic problems consisting of addition and subtraction operations as a combination of a backtracking search problem and a constraint satisfaction problem in python. The next substantial instance was the sphinx magazine mentioned above, where some of the puzzles proposed there are quite dif. Pigeolet published most of his puzzles there between 1931 and. Cryptarithmetic problem is a type of constraint satisfaction problem where the game is about digits and its unique replacement either with alphabets or other symbols. Books on cryptarithmetic alphametic puzzle solver alphametic. I n cryptarithmetic puzzles, mathematical equations are written using letters. Ive included my coded solution under this walk through solution. Solving cryptarithmetic problems using parallel genetic algorithm. Cryptarithms in each of the cryptharithms below, each letter stands for a different digit 0 is never the first digit of any number. Computer engineering assignment help, cryptarithmetic problem in artificial intelligence, solve the following cryptarithmetic problem using prolog. But assuming d1 will not give you the solutionswhy. Assigning digits to letters in the following way would be an acceptable solution which is arithmetically correct.
Pdf solution of a classical cryptarithmetic problem by using. Cryptarithmetic problems are where numbers are replaced with alphabets. A generic solver for constraint satisfaction problems. In fractions of a second, the program will list th. Infosys cryptarithmetic questions with answers 2019 20. Cryptic math puzzles, cryptarithms try you hand at these alphametics. First problem, in x t,w,o,s,i,x,e,l,v, you chose name x for the list of all variables, but you already have a variable with name x. The first few have explanations which gives you some clues on how to solve this type of puzzle.
In this assignment, you will implement a program that solves cryptarithmetic problems using backtracking and the most constrained variable heuristic. By using standard arithmetic rules we need to decipher the alphabet. Selected topics in cryptography solved exam problems enes pasalic university of primorska koper, 20. How to solve cryptarithmetic problems 03 elitmuszone. Since, at max you will add three numbers in cryptarithmetic problems. Assuming two character cant have the same value, my thought process was first to try a. Github nagularitvikasolvingcryptarithmeticproblems. The numerical base, unless specifically stated, is 10. Solving cryptarithmetic problems using parallel genetic algorithm reza abbasian department of computer engineering shahid chamran university ahvaz, iran reza. Simple cryptarithmetic puzzle solver in java, c, and python simplesolver. In fractions of a second, the program will list the solutions to the problem. Practice question from the elitmuszone and other related materials as much as you can.
So carry over in problems of two number addition is always 1. The invention of cryptarithmetic has been ascribed to ancient china. Even fairly good students, when they have obtained the solution of the problem and written down neatly the argument, shut their books and look for something else. Every characterletter must have a unique and distinct value. Get answer in cryptarithmetic puzzles, mathematical. Every time you submit an alphametic for solution, 3 different outcomes may occur. Applications of ai ai has applications in all fields of human study, such as finance and economics, environmental. Learn the quickest ways to solve infosys cryptarithmetic questions and answers, rules, tricks and tips and all the formulas required to be learnt. We can turn any regular addition, subtraction, multiplication, or division problem into a cryptarithm by replacing the numbers with letters. Each alphabet takes only one number from 0 to 9 uniquely. Because if d1 then cryptarithmetic problem will be so much easier to solve, which you should never expect from elitmus. The constraints of defining a cryptarithmetic problem are as follows.
Infosys cryptarithmetic questions and answers pdf rules. There are two words are given and another word is given an answer of addition for those two words. As a programmer, i naturally gave this a go as soon as i saw it with the aid of a computer. In the crypt arithmetic problem, some letters are used to assign digits to it. Genetic programming starts from a highlevel statement of what needs to be done and automatically creates a computer program to solve the problem.
Problem definition cryptarithm is a genre of mathematical puzzles in which the digits are replaced by letters of the alphabet. The most repeated cryptarithmetic questions and answers are discussed here. Solving elitmus cryptarithmetic questions in logical reasioning sectionmethodii. I found a set of values which is a solution, but only one solution in an infinite set. How to solve cryptarithmetic problems 01 elitmuszone. Each letter can be a digit from 0 to 9, but no two letters can be the same. Newest cryptarithmeticpuzzle questions stack overflow. Cryptarithmetic is the science and art of creating and solving cryptarithms. New pattern cryptarithmetic multiplication problems. Pdf cryptarithmetic is a class of constraint satisfaction problems which includes making mathematical relations between meaningful words using simple. Contribute to doriczaparicrypt development by creating an account on github. Simple cryptarithmetic puzzle solver in java, c, and. I myself solved those 3 questions just by reading this tutorial. Pdf solving cryptarithmetic problems using parallel genetic.
Cryptarithmetic is a suitable example of the constraint satisfaction problem. Cryptarithmetic problems with solutions crt tutorial. The goal is to find the digits such that a given mathematical equation is verified. Now in the third column from the left in the example the sum of the digits w, u, and w must be more than 9, since 1 had to be carried over from this column into the column on the left. In this section, we describe the problem and propose a first model to solve it.
The main part of this program is written in llp a linear logic programming language. The candidates can also use the score to apply to all participating companies for a period of 2 years. You can solve cryptarithmetic problems with either the new cpsat solver, which is more efficient, or the original cp solver. Cryptarithmetic requires certain amount of logical thinking and reasoning. The ph test score is in form of percentile which helps candidates benchmark themselves against the national talent pool. Solving cryptarithmetic puzzles backtracking8 perfect sum problem construct a doubly linked. May 26, 2015 firstly go through the cryptarithmetic tutorial in sequence mentioned below and then try to solve the problem by your own. There are certain rules and principles that are necessary to understand while solving the crypt arithmetic questions. Ai cryptarithmetic problems for beginners tutorial part1. The idea here is that it tries all possible combinations of numbers from 0 to 10 and all numbers that are. It involves the decoding of digit represented by a character. Now that your system is up and running if not, see getting started, let us solve a cryptarithmetic puzzle with the help of the ortools library.
630 464 880 969 1120 374 351 1206 450 472 1556 1158 64 1080 1018 1452 903 816 129 537 356 994 656 224 1432 1088 1576 795 938 293 1079 964 1162 560 999 1188 1330 753 469 561 568 366 908